
Новые сообщения [новые:0]
Дайджест
Горячие темы
Избранное [новые:0]
Форумы
Пользователи
Статистика
Статистика нагрузки
Мод. лог
Поиск
|
|
01.09.2004, 11:28:35
|
|||
|---|---|---|---|
adp - изменения не возможны recordset не обновляемый |
|||
|
#18+
Кто сталкивался с такой проблемой проект ADP Vew на сервере - обновляемая, т.е. можно вносить изменения цепляю ее как источник строк к форме, изменения вносить не дает, говорит что рекордсет не обновляемый так же вообще все View и таблицы в проекте, ни какие изменения внести не могу. в пораметрах подключения указываю Windows nt authentification ... короче вход как в windows при чем при таком же подключении через ODBC из MDB изменения вносить можно... Помогите, кто с таким сталкивался?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
|
|
|
01.09.2004, 11:32:52
|
|||
|---|---|---|---|
|
|||
adp - изменения не возможны recordset не обновляемый |
|||
|
#18+
см. св-во формы "Однозначная таблица" ... |
|||
|
:
Нравится:
Не нравится:
|
|||
|
|
|
01.09.2004, 11:33:13
|
|||
|---|---|---|---|
adp - изменения не возможны recordset не обновляемый |
|||
|
#18+
Текст вьюхи в студию.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
|
|
|
01.09.2004, 11:41:54
|
|||
|---|---|---|---|
adp - изменения не возможны recordset не обновляемый |
|||
|
#18+
текст View до безобразия прост select * from sent_tlg where doe beteen convert (datetime, '01,08,2004', 103) and convert (datetime, '01,09,2004', 103) Структура таблицы Код: plaintext 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
|
|
|
01.09.2004, 11:46:14
|
|||
|---|---|---|---|
adp - изменения не возможны recordset не обновляемый |
|||
|
#18+
однозначная таблица первичный ключ строка синхронизации ... |
|||
|
:
Нравится:
Не нравится:
|
|||
|
|
|
01.09.2004, 11:49:29
|
|||
|---|---|---|---|
adp - изменения не возможны recordset не обновляемый |
|||
|
#18+
где здесь create view ? почему таблица без примари кей ?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
|
|
|
01.09.2004, 11:51:12
|
|||
|---|---|---|---|
adp - изменения не возможны recordset не обновляемый |
|||
|
#18+
сорри, слона не заметил. авторselect * from sent_tlg where doe between convert (datetime, '01,08,2004', 103) and convert (datetime, '01,09,2004', 103) ... |
|||
|
:
Нравится:
Не нравится:
|
|||
|
|
|
01.09.2004, 11:53:14
|
|||
|---|---|---|---|
|
|||
adp - изменения не возможны recordset не обновляемый |
|||
|
#18+
АлексейКсорри, слона не заметил. Однако заметил наличие отсутствия первичного ключа ... |
|||
|
:
Нравится:
Не нравится:
|
|||
|
|
|
01.09.2004, 11:56:43
|
|||
|---|---|---|---|
adp - изменения не возможны recordset не обновляемый |
|||
|
#18+
АлексейК почему таблица без примари кей ? Код: plaintext ... |
|||
|
:
Нравится:
Не нравится:
|
|||
|
|
|
01.09.2004, 11:58:56
|
|||
|---|---|---|---|
|
|||
adp - изменения не возможны recordset не обновляемый |
|||
|
#18+
А ты видешь там слова Primary Key? Это поле у тебя даже не уникально. Не знаю как в MS SQL, а в mdb счетчик без уникального индекса вполне себе может дублироваться ... |
|||
|
:
Нравится:
Не нравится:
|
|||
|
|
|
01.09.2004, 11:59:01
|
|||
|---|---|---|---|
adp - изменения не возможны recordset не обновляемый |
|||
|
#18+
ALTER TABLE [dbo].[sent_tlg] ADD CONSTRAINT [PK_sent_tlg] PRIMARY KEY CLUSTERED ( [st_id] ) ON [PRIMARY] GO ... |
|||
|
:
Нравится:
Не нравится:
|
|||
|
|
|
01.09.2004, 11:59:50
|
|||
|---|---|---|---|
adp - изменения не возможны recordset не обновляемый |
|||
|
#18+
Всем спасибо Установка Primary key помогло...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
|
|
|
01.09.2004, 12:05:05
|
|||
|---|---|---|---|
adp - изменения не возможны recordset не обновляемый |
|||
|
#18+
авторVew на сервере - обновляемая, т.е. можно вносить изменения а вот это странно, обычно такие вьюхи если открыть из аксесса в виде таблицы необновляемые ...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
|
|
|
01.09.2004, 12:07:19
|
|||
|---|---|---|---|
|
|||
adp - изменения не возможны recordset не обновляемый |
|||
|
#18+
При линковке через ODBC можно указать уникальную комбинацию полей даже если она не является первичным ключом в таблице (и вообще даже не уникальна ) ... |
|||
|
:
Нравится:
Не нравится:
|
|||
|
|
|
01.09.2004, 12:20:18
|
|||
|---|---|---|---|
adp - изменения не возможны recordset не обновляемый |
|||
|
#18+
ЛП, интересный момент. точно при линковке спрашивает ключ, правда всегда старался делать по честному - сначала правильная таблица с примари кей, потом линковка. но здесь проект ADP...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
|
|
|
01.09.2004, 12:21:33
|
|||
|---|---|---|---|
|
|||
adp - изменения не возможны recordset не обновляемый |
|||
|
#18+
но здесь проект ADP... Потому и необновляемое ... |
|||
|
:
Нравится:
Не нравится:
|
|||
|
|
|
01.09.2004, 12:35:32
|
|||
|---|---|---|---|
adp - изменения не возможны recordset не обновляемый |
|||
|
#18+
АлексейК авторVew на сервере - обновляемая, т.е. можно вносить изменения а вот это странно, обычно такие вьюхи если открыть из аксесса в виде таблицы необновляемые ... А помоему ничего странного... по крайней мере я сталкивался с проблемой обновления данных на сервере (при отсутствии в таблице primary key и identity) только в том случае, если записи идентичны полностью, тогда сервер не знает какую обновлять, а если различия есть, то он как то сам вычисляет че ему надо обновить... (из практики) а потом я говорил про view на сервере... т.е. конкретно из Interprise Manager она была обновляемая, а из Acc нет ... |
|||
|
:
Нравится:
Не нравится:
|
|||
|
|
|

start [/forum/topic.php?fid=45&mobile=1&tid=1672054]: |
0ms |
get settings: |
7ms |
get forum list: |
14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
37ms |
get topic data: |
11ms |
get forum data: |
3ms |
get page messages: |
60ms |
get tp. blocked users: |
1ms |
| others: | 200ms |
| total: | 339ms |

| 0 / 0 |
